What is your typical process for working with a new student?
First, I try to get a good understanding of what the student's goals for tutoring are! Based on these goals, we will create an agenda for the sessions together. It is important to me to set goals for a session ahead of time so that the student has time to engage with the material beforehand.
I think being willing to adjust goals based on what is working and what isn't is just as important as setting them in the first place. I communicate with students along the way to understand how they think things are going, share my perspective, and adjust to find a better individualized strategy if necessary!
